What's the Latest Buzz? (News Sentiment)

Looking at the recent news, there's a definite mix of good stuff happening, though analysts seem a tiny bit less bullish on the exact price target than before.

First off, the company dropped its first-quarter results for 2025. And guess what? Net income and earnings per share were actually up compared to both the previous quarter and the same time last year. That's solid news, showing the business is performing well right now. Their net interest margin, basically how much money they make from lending versus what they pay out, looks healthy too at 4.15%.

Big news also hit about them expanding! Enterprise Bank & Trust is planning to buy twelve banking offices from First Interstate Bank. This move will push them into new areas like Arizona and Kansas, which is a clear sign they're looking to grow their footprint. Expanding the business is usually seen as a positive step.

On the analyst front, we saw a couple of reports. Both DA Davidson and Keefe, Bruyette & Woods kept their positive ratings on the stock – "Buy" and "Outperform," respectively. That's good; they still like the company. However, both firms did slightly lower their price targets. DA Davidson went from $70 to $65, and Keefe, Bruyette & Woods moved from $69 to $66. So, while they still think the stock has room to run, they've dialed back their expectations just a touch.

There was also news about some executive leadership changes planned for the fourth quarter. This isn't necessarily good or bad on its own; it's more about managing transitions within the company.

Putting the news together, the vibe is mostly positive, driven by good earnings and clear expansion plans. The slight dip in analyst price targets adds a note of caution, but the overall sentiment from the news flow seems favorable.

A Little More Context

Remember, Enterprise Financial Services is primarily a regional bank. This means its business is heavily tied to the economic health of the areas it operates in (like Missouri, Arizona, Kansas, etc.). The acquisition news is particularly relevant because it directly impacts their core banking business and geographic reach. The fact that they have a relatively low P/E ratio compared to others in the banking industry, as noted in the data, could be why some see it as potentially "undervalued."
